Unlocking Opportunities: Converting Commercial Properties into Affordable Housing

In the face of rising housing costs and a growing need for affordable housing, cities around the world are exploring innovative solutions to address this pressing issue. One such solution gaining traction is the conversion of commercial properties into affordable housing units. This approach not only repurposes underutilized spaces but also provides much-needed housing options for individuals and families facing financial constraints. Let's explore the opportunities and benefits of this transformative strategy.


The Need for Affordable Housing


The scarcity of affordable housing is a significant challenge in many urban areas. Rising property prices, coupled with stagnant wages, have made it increasingly difficult for low and middle-income individuals to find suitable accommodation. As a result, many communities are grappling with homelessness, overcrowding, and housing insecurity.


Repurposing Commercial Properties


Converting commercial properties, such as office buildings, hotels, and retail spaces, into affordable housing presents a unique opportunity to address the housing crisis. These properties often sit vacant or underutilized, making them prime candidates for transformation.


 Opportunities and Benefits


 1. Cost-Effectiveness


Converting existing commercial properties into affordable housing is often more cost-effective than building new structures from the ground up. The basic infrastructure is already in place, reducing construction time and expenses.


 2. Adaptive Reuse


Adaptive reuse of commercial properties preserves the character and history of existing buildings while meeting the evolving needs of communities. It allows for creative redesigns that can result in unique and attractive housing options.


 3. Revitalization of Neighborhoods


Converting vacant commercial properties into housing can breathe new life into struggling neighborhoods. It can stimulate economic growth, attract new residents, and create vibrant, mixed-use communities.


 4. Addressing Homelessness


By repurposing commercial properties into affordable housing, cities can provide shelter for individuals experiencing homelessness. This approach offers a more dignified and permanent solution compared to temporary shelters.


 5. Meeting Demand


Converting commercial properties into affordable housing helps meet the growing demand for housing in urban areas. It provides more options for low and middle-income individuals and families who are priced out of the traditional housing market.


 Challenges and Considerations


While the conversion of commercial properties into affordable housing offers numerous benefits, it is not without its challenges. Zoning regulations, building codes, financing, and community opposition are all factors that must be carefully considered and addressed.


Conclusion:


Converting commercial properties into affordable housing presents a promising solution to the pressing issue of housing affordability. By leveraging existing infrastructure and resources, cities can create more inclusive and sustainable communities. As the demand for affordable housing continues to rise, innovative approaches like this will play a crucial role in ensuring that everyone has access to safe, secure, and affordable housing.
